Instagram model, Jade Ramey, a woman named in recent legal documents as one of Sean “Diddy” Combs’ sex workers, is speaking out.

Ramey’s publicist, Eve Sarkisyan, denied the accusations outlined in producer, Rodney “Lil Rod” Jones’ lawsuit against the rapper, in a statement to Entertainment Tonight. 

“Dating someone doesn’t directly correlate to any of the false allegations made,” Ramey said, via her rep.

“Yes, I dated someone,” she said. “How unfortunate we’ve entered a time where caring for someone or falling in love is worthy of scrutiny in the court of public opinion. What may be amusing for you is real life for others, and my feelings have never been for entertainment, nor are they up for discussion.”

The IG model concluded — “We need to be more conscious as a society when ridiculing people’s lives and relationships merely for enjoyment. I appreciate everyone’s kind messages and support during this time. Thank you.”

Jones claimed in his $30 million lawsuit that the billionaire music mogul hired Ramey, as well as Girls rapper Yung Miami and Daphne Joy, the ex of 50 Cent, as sex workers. The producer alleged that an accountant named Robin Greenhill issued payments to the women, in court documents.

The lawsuit stated — “Upon information and belief, Defendants Lucian Charles Grainge, in his capacity as CEO of UMG, authorized Motown Records and Universal Music Group to provide financial resources to Defendants Sean Combs and Love Records through wire transfers to Defendants Sean Combs and Love Records accountant Robin Greenhill.”

Documents read — “Upon information and belief, Ms. Greenhill ensured the wiring, funds transfer, or cash payments to sex workers were completed.” 

Joy has since denied the allegations against her in the lawsuit.

Ramey and Combs’ first sparked romance rumors when they were spotted kissing, back in December 2022. The sighting came only days after Combs’ announced the arrival his youngest daughter, Love, whom he shares with Dana Tran. 

Jones claimed that he was sexually assaulted and forced into inappropriate behavior with sex workers, at Combs’ request, while producing his 2023 album, “The Love Album: Off the Grid.”

Jones accused Combs, 54, of “constant unsolicited and unauthorized groping and touching of his anus” in the lawsuit. 

Combs’ lawyer, Shawn Holley, denied the claims, telling Us Weekly in a statement — “Lil Rod is nothing more than a liar who filed a $30 million lawsuit, shamelessly looking for an undeserved payday. We have overwhelming, indisputable proof that his claims are complete lies. We will address these outlandish allegations in court and take all appropriate action against those who make them.”

On Monday, March 25, the Department of Homeland Security raided the musician’s Los Angeles and Miami estates as part of a federal sex trafficking investigation. 

Combs has since been seen in Miami, seemingly unfazed by his legal woes and the ongoing federal investigation.
